Key Responsibilities:

  • Delivering and collecting goods from all Frasers Group stores (handball work required).
  • Work on a 4-on, 2-off rotational pattern, including weekends, nights, and early mornings.
  • Hold valid passes; good timekeeping, reliability, fitness, communication, and safety awareness are essential.
  • Demonstrate excellent driving, navigation skills, and ability to work independently or as part of a team.

Company Requirements:

  • Valid UK Driving Licence, Driver Card, and DCPC Card.
  • Maximum of 6 penalty points; no DR or DD endorsements.

Additional Information:

  • Up to £32.88 per hour.
  • 28 days holiday including statutory holidays.
  • 20% staff discount, onsite gym and parking, subsidised DCPC.
  • Excellent weekend rates.
